Frequently Asked Questions

#I’m currently a member, where does my existing membership stand?

Patrons who held a membership in 2025 will continue to receive the benefits of their membership until 31 December 2025. All 2026 Season memberships commence on 1 January and will expire on 31 December 2026. Memberships go on sale in September to ensure Members gain pre-sale access to Season Packages.


#Are memberships rolling or for a specific period?

All memberships are valid for one calendar year (1 Jan – 31 Dec) and must be renewed ahead of the following calendar year for ongoing access to benefits. Activation and expiry dates are viewable on your digital membership card or in the Member Portal.  


#How do I register for events and stay up to date?

Registration and payment for events will open six weeks prior to each event. Once open, bookings can be made via the website and the Member Portal. You will receive Member Mail quarterly providing key updates, upcoming event notifications and other important information.  


#I’m a previous subscription ticket holder, will I still get priority access for 2026?

Yes! Existing subscription holders, donors and members will be invited to book their 2026 Season Package from the moment our new season launches – before bookings open for the general public.  

We are in the process of finalising our plans for the 2026 season launch and will be able to share the priority booking period and launch dates with you very soon. 


#How do I add my digital card to my phone and where can I find it?

Within 1 business day of purchasing a membership you will receive a welcome email inviting you to download your digital card. Once downloaded, your digital card will live in your smartphone’s wallet. 


#How do I use my digital card to access information about my membership and events?

Locate your digital card in your phone wallet. In the top right-hand corner of your phone screen you will see an icon with three dots – click on this and select ‘Pass Details’. Details include a welcome message, link to the Membership Portal, link to RSVP to Member events and all the inclusions of your Membership. From time to time you will receive notifications with reminders to RSVP to events and exclusive offers. This information lives at the bottom of the ‘Pass Details’ screen and is updated as new notifications are shared.  


#How do I Access the Member Portal?

The easiest way to access the Member Portal is via your digital card. Locate your digital card in your phone wallet. In the top right-hand corner of your phone screen you will see an icon with three dots – click on this and select ‘Pass Details’. There is a direct link to the Member Portal. 


#I prefer not to/am unable to use a digital membership card, what can I do?

By default, all members will receive a digital membership card sent to the email address you provide. Please contact us directly if you require a physical card alternative.  


#Can I extend my membership inclusions and benefits to friends?

No. Your membership is an individual membership, and benefits only apply to the member named on the card. Producer members are entitled to bring a guest into the Members Lounge.  


#How do I cancel my membership?

You can cancel your membership at any time and will continue to have access to your benefits through to the end of your billing period. Please note once purchased memberships are non-refundable, transferable, exchangeable or redeemable for cash.
